Funke Akindele’s A Tribe Called Judah just hit a tremendous record as the first ever Nollywood movie to hit one billion naira at the Nigerian box office. The movie has broken records on all fronts since it was released on 15 December 2023.

As the highest grossing Nollywood Film, A Tribe Called Judah will go down in cinematic history as the first Nollywood movie to gross one billion naira nationwide in just three weeks.

The news officially broke in a press statement released by Film One Studios on Thursday, January 4, 2024. It stated "This cinematic masterpiece has not only captured hearts but shattered records, becoming the FIRST Nollywood movie to soar past the 1 Billion Naira Milestone at the box office.”

There’s also been a lot of speculation from skeptics who find the numbers a little bit hard to believe, but based on the reports, there is a clear indication that the movie did remarkably well in cinemas, so hopefully, we’re on the right side of history.

Based on reports from the Cinema Exhibitors Association of Nigeria (CEAN), by the end of 2023 the movie had a total gross of ₦854.3 million, which inevitably makes it the highest-grossing Nollywood title for 2023 and the highest ever. A Tribe Called Judah is a story of five brothers: Jide Kene Achufusi as Emeka Judah, Timini Egbuson as Pere Judah, Uzee Usman as Adamu Judah, Tobi Makinde as Shina Judah, and Olumide Oworu as Ejiro Judah, they must all join forces to rob a company to save their mother, Jedidah Judah, played by Funke Akindele.
